当前位置: 首页 > news >正文

如何快速掌握AKShare金融数据接口库:新手入门完整指南

如何快速掌握AKShare金融数据接口库:新手入门完整指南

【免费下载链接】akshare项目地址: https://gitcode.com/gh_mirrors/aks/akshare

想要获取金融数据却苦于找不到合适的工具?AKShare作为Python生态中的明星金融数据接口库,为量化交易者、数据分析师和科研人员提供了全面的数据解决方案。本指南将带你从零开始,轻松掌握这一强大工具的使用技巧。🚀

为什么选择AKShare作为你的金融数据助手

AKShare金融数据接口库拥有众多优势,让它成为众多用户的首选:

  • 数据覆盖面广:从股票、基金到期货、期权,几乎涵盖所有主流金融市场
  • 接口设计简洁:函数命名规范,参数设置清晰,上手难度低
  • 完全免费开源:无需付费订阅,代码透明可定制
  • 持续更新维护:紧跟市场变化,及时添加新功能

三步完成环境搭建:新手友好配置方案

基础环境检查清单

在开始使用AKShare之前,请确认你的系统满足以下条件:

  • 操作系统:Windows、macOS或Linux均可
  • Python版本:3.8及以上,推荐3.11
  • 网络连接:能够正常访问金融数据源

快速安装指南

根据你的使用习惯,选择最适合的安装方式:

标准安装方案

pip install akshare --upgrade

国内用户加速方案

pip install akshare -i https://pypi.tuna.tsinghua.edu.cn/simple/

核心功能模块详解:找到你需要的数据

股票数据获取宝库

股票数据接口位于akshare/stock/目录下,提供:

  • 实时行情数据监控
  • 历史价格走势分析
  • 财务指标深度挖掘

基金债券数据体系

基金和债券模块分别位于akshare/fund/akshare/bond/目录,包含:

  • 公募基金净值更新
  • 债券收益率曲线
  • 基金持仓结构分析

期货期权衍生品数据

期货期权数据接口分布在akshare/futures/akshare/option/目录,提供:

  • 期货合约详细信息
  • 期权定价相关数据
  • 衍生品市场风险指标

实用技巧分享:提升数据获取效率

数据缓存优化策略

通过合理设置缓存机制,可以显著减少重复请求次数,提高数据获取速度。

批量处理方案

对于需要获取多只股票或多种数据的情况,建议使用批量处理模式,避免频繁的单个请求。

常见问题解决方案:遇到困难不再慌

依赖库安装问题

如果遇到lxml、requests等依赖库安装失败,可以尝试分步安装:

pip install requests lxml beautifulsoup4 pip install akshare

网络连接异常

数据获取过程中出现网络问题,可以:

  • 检查网络连接状态
  • 调整请求超时时间
  • 使用稳定的网络环境

进阶应用场景:发挥AKShare的最大价值

量化投资数据支撑

AKShare为量化策略开发提供:

  • 价格时间序列数据
  • 技术指标计算基础
  • 市场资金流向分析

学术研究数据源建设

科研人员可以利用AKShare构建:

  • 金融市场研究数据库
  • 宏观经济指标库
  • 资产定价验证数据集

通过本指南的系统学习,你将能够快速上手AKShare金融数据接口库,为你的投资分析和金融研究提供强有力的数据支持。建议定期关注项目更新,及时获取最新功能特性,让你的数据分析工作更加得心应手!💪

【免费下载链接】akshare项目地址: https://gitcode.com/gh_mirrors/aks/akshare

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/179818/

相关文章:

  • ALU加法器集成原理:快速理解进位链结构作用
  • RPFM完全实战手册:从入门到精通的Total War模组制作指南
  • 如何快速创建专业级3D风场可视化:cesium-wind完整指南
  • Excel文件批量搜索革命:QueryExcel让数据查找变得如此简单
  • Tableau连接CosyVoice3数据源创建交互式看板
  • 2025年质量好的染色纱线厂家用户好评推荐 - 行业平台推荐
  • YimMenu:GTA V游戏增强工具完整使用教程
  • NSudo终极指南:彻底解决Windows权限管理难题
  • TuxGuitar吉他制谱软件终极指南:从零开始快速上手
  • CosyVoice3与MyBatisPlus结合实现语音日志持久化存储
  • Translumo屏幕翻译工具:打破语言障碍的智能解决方案
  • WinBtrfs驱动:让Windows原生支持Btrfs文件系统的完整解决方案
  • DownGit:重新定义GitHub文件夹下载体验的新范式
  • 小爱音乐Docker部署终极指南:5步打造智能音乐中枢
  • MeshLab终极指南:轻松掌握3D网格处理与模型修复技巧
  • CosyVoice3输出文件命名规则说明及批量处理脚本分享
  • Unity游戏Mod管理核心技术:动态注入与运行时控制详解
  • NormalMap-Online:零基础也能快速生成专业级法线贴图的免费神器
  • 手把手教你解析通过USB转485驱动传输的数据包
  • Revelation光影包:重塑Minecraft视觉体验的终极指南
  • 3步搞定Beyond Compare专业版:本地授权生成终极方案
  • 终极指南:用Legacy-iOS-Kit让旧iPhone重获新生
  • 终极免费视频下载神器:VideoDownloadHelper浏览器扩展完整指南
  • 多轴同步控制中的电机控制器策略:深度剖析原理
  • 如何用JavaScript监听CosyVoice3生成完成事件?
  • 3步精通浏览器视频下载:VideoDownloadHelper完整操作手册
  • 抖音批量下载神器:5步掌握专业内容管理技巧
  • 3步上手:用Cesium-Wind实现惊艳的3D风场动态效果
  • MGV3000刷Armbian系统终极教程:从吃灰神器到全能服务器大改造
  • BlenderGIS完整指南:从地理数据到3D场景的终极转换方案